Erlam, Wiens medal at diving nationals
Competing on home turf, Saskatoon’s Margo Erlam and Pike Lake’s Rylan Wiens both medalled at the Winter National Diving Championships over the weekend in Saskatoon.
Erlam claimed double gold, winning the women’s one-metre event with a score of 289.30 points and followed that up with a 377.65 point performance to take top spot in the 3-m event as well.
Meanwhile, Wiens, set broke a 15-year-old national record in the men’s platform event, scoring 545.95 points.
Newkirk, Ens compete at swimming trials
Para swimmers Shelby Newkirk of Saskatoon and Nikita Ens of Meadow Lake both had a successful competition at the Canadian Trials April 5-10 in Victoria.
Newkirk took first place in three of her races, finishing the 100-metre freestyle in a time of one minute and 15.54 seconds, good enough to set a new Canadian record, as well as won the 50-m freestyle with a time of 34.20 seconds and the 100-m backstroke in a time of 1:20.76.
Meanwhile, Ens took first place in the 150-m individual medley.
Thibeault headed to boxing worlds
Saskatoon-born boxer Tammara Thibeault is headed to Turkey for the World Boxing Championships May 6-21.
Thibeault, who won bronze the last time the championships were held in 2019, will compete in the 75-kilogram weight class.
